¿Cómo depurar una infraestructura DLNA?

11

Estoy atrapado en una situación peculiar en casa y agradecería cualquier ayuda.

Yo tengo:

  • Receptor AV Marantz NR1504, conectado a través de PowerLan y Ethernet al enrutador / módem.
  • Samsung SmartTV, conectado por WiFi al mismo enrutador.
  • Teléfonos inteligentes Android, con BubbleUPnP, conectados por WiFi al mismo enrutador.
  • Synology DS414 se conecta a través de Ethernet directamente al mismo enrutador.

Synology lleva una colección de archivos musicales, MP3 y FLAC. Pude acceder a esta colección desde el televisor, el receptor y BubbleUPnP. Podía reproducirlos directamente desde el receptor, reproducirlos usando el televisor con sonido con retorno HDMI, o usar mi teléfono inteligente para acceder a la colección musical y reproducir el sonido con el receptor.

Synology sirve los archivos musicales usando Media Server.

Para resumir, la situación era así:

  • BubbpleUPnP pudo ver la colección musical en Synology y pudo ver el receptor.
  • Receiver pudo ver la colección musical en Synology y pudo ver BubbleUPnP.
  • La televisión pudo ver la colección musical en Synology.

Todo funcionó bien, hasta algún momento. No utilicé todas las funciones todo el tiempo, así que no sé cuándo salieron exactamente las cosas. Sin embargo, actualmente la situación es así:

  • BubbleUPnP no ve Synology en absoluto; Todavía ve el receptor.
  • El receptor no ve Synology en absoluto. Ve BubbleUPnP.
  • La televisión puede ver Synology perfectamente, con todos los archivos multimedia.
  • Synology's Media Server muestra TV, BubbleUPnP y el receptor en Media Server> Compatibilidad DMA> Lista de dispositivos.

Entonces:

  • Dos canales DLNA funcionan bien: TV — Synology y BubbleUPnP — receptor.
  • Dos canales DLNA funcionan de una manera: Synology ve BubbleUPnP y el receptor, pero no al revés.

Me pregunto si hay un enfoque "estándar" o recomendado para depurar dicha configuración. Dado que involucra múltiples proveedores y dispositivos y una configuración de red bastante compleja, ni siquiera sabría qué soporte técnico pedir. Por otro lado, creo que debería haber algún conocimiento para resolver este tipo de problemas, y eso es lo que estoy buscando.

texnic
fuente

Respuestas:

4

Estos problemas siempre son difíciles de resolver. El enfoque que adopto es documentar primero cada interfaz de red en cada dispositivo, incluidos los enrutadores, los puntos de acceso y los adaptadores POWERlan. Registre la dirección MAC, la dirección IP, la puerta de enlace predeterminada, la máscara de red y el nombre de host.

Ahora, vaya a su servidor DHCP principal (probablemente en su enrutador doméstico) y asegúrese de que sus registros muestren exactamente las mismas direcciones MAC que registró, y que cada MAC recibió las mismas direcciones IP que vio. Una diferencia puede significar que accidentalmente ha habilitado un segundo servidor DHCP (tal vez oculto en un punto de acceso barato, extensor de rango WiFi o adaptador POWERlan) que podría estar creando configuraciones de red falsas en algunos de sus dispositivos, dividiendo su red en dos.

Asegúrese de que todos sus dispositivos estén en la misma subred. Eso significa que todos tienen la misma máscara de red, y los bits superiores son todos iguales entre sí. Por ejemplo, si la máscara de red de su enrutador es 255.255.255.0, todos sus dispositivos deben tener sus 3 octetos principales en común con la puerta de enlace predeterminada y entre sí, como 192.168.1.1, 192.168.1.2 y 192.168.1.3

En una red doméstica pequeña como la que ha descrito, esperaría que todos los dispositivos compartan una puerta de enlace predeterminada común. Asegúrese de que sea la red interna frente a la dirección IP de su enrutador.

Si cree que puede ser un problema deshonesto de DHCP pero simplemente no puede entender qué está pasando, considere convertir todas sus interfaces de red para usar direcciones IP estáticas.

John Deters
fuente
¿Has confundido DLNA y DHCP?
Sean Houlihane
3
@SeanHoulihane, no, pero según la descripción, creo que la causa raíz es un problema de red. Una vez que consigue que todos los nodos de la red se comuniquen correctamente, creo que sus problemas de DLNA desaparecerán. He visto un comportamiento muy similar antes cuando configuré accidentalmente un pequeño enrutador TP-Link para que sirviera como punto de acceso, pero dejé dhcpd ejecutándose, lo que comenzó a secuestrar otros nodos de red al azar.
John Deters